Output 76cf8016d215c71666299d980a62123c8820e77d7f3782cf7be259ff21ef310d:3

value
1083973
script pubkey
OP_0 OP_PUSHBYTES_20 eb13427831b200ed6ebe0d3b2e68869a5ad82d8b
address
bc1qavf5y7p3kgqw6m47p5aju6yxnfddstvtwzwase
transaction
76cf8016d215c71666299d980a62123c8820e77d7f3782cf7be259ff21ef310d
spent
true